What’s 2021 Been Like for Legal Tech Companies? Consider Evisort, which Doubled its Revenue

LawSites

Want to know what kind of year this has been for legal technology companies? The company, which provides AI-driven contract management, is today releasing a year-end report that reveals that it has doubled both its revenue and headcount in 2021. It would be naïve to suggest that every legal technology company thrived this year.

Evolving Legal Tech: Is Artificial Intelligence(AI) The Right Approach?

CaseFox

Enrouting AI in Legal Tech AI has its roots in almost every business vertical including legal tech. AI is getting proficient at assisting various legal services such as contract management, legal predictions, eDiscovery, and sooner or later courtroom hearings.

13 Tips to Avoid the Legal Ops Pricing Money Pit

Bigfork Tech

13 Tips to Avoid the Legal Ops Pricing Money Pit We’ve talked to a lot of people in the market for legal ops tools and here is what we often hear: most legal ops solutions come with hidden costs. Common complaints: extra charges for managed services, Outlook integration, customized workflows, tailored templates, etc.
